Question 110933: HOW MANY YEARS WILL IT TAKE $3000 TO GROW TO $4667 IF IT IS INVESTED AT AN ANNUAL RATE OF 13%, COMPOUNDED CONTINUOUSLY? ROUND YOUR ANSWER TO ONE DECIMAL PLACE.
Answer by stanbon(75887) (Show Source): You can put this solution on YOUR website!
HOW MANY YEARS WILL IT TAKE $3000 TO GROW TO $4667 IF IT IS INVESTED AT AN ANNUAL RATE OF 13%, COMPOUNDED CONTINUOUSLY? ROUND YOUR ANSWER TO ONE DECIMAL PLACE.
-------------
A(t) = Ao*e^rt
4667 = 3000*e^(0.13t)
e^(0.13t) = 1.555666666
Take the natural log to get:
0.13t = 0.441904...
t = 3.4 years
